Transaction 76a142e5e5b2d3c538fdfab54a5676dfbc78f15e23258e06e81654efdbb1f7a3

5 Input
2 Outputs
  • 76a142e5e5b2d3c538fdfab54a5676dfbc78f15e23258e06e81654efdbb1f7a3:0
  • value  1156075578
    address  36UGrWTqeNgwEsZQhWFcC3BMFfmtCpyvMZ
  • 76a142e5e5b2d3c538fdfab54a5676dfbc78f15e23258e06e81654efdbb1f7a3:1
  • value  175823856
    address  3Dvaajxs8D2ASFLsjkcpmTSrKzXyEr4Kkx